The Government has extended the Pandemic Unemployment Payment until the end of March 2021 to support employees and businesses who continue to be impacted by the on-going public health restrictions. I have also secured approval to keep the scheme open to new applicants until the end of the year.
This means that anyone who loses their employment as a result of the pandemic between now and the end of the year will be able to avail of this payment. It also means that anyone who closes their claim to take up employment and subsequently loses that employment as a result of the pandemic will be able to re-apply for the Pandemic Unemployment Payment.
